Bad Texans team? That team was getting 9 wins with Brock Osweiler, Tom Savage, and Brian Hoyer starting games. Not long before that, Matt Schaub was pulling in 12 wins and 10 wins. The Texans were a team that, with the exception of 2013, was competitive regardless of QB play for years until Watson got there, so don't feed me that "bad team" narrative. People say bad team because in Watson's last year they went 4-12...something I thought a "top tier QB" was supposedly top tier because a top tier QB would never go 4-12.

I don't necessarily see Watson as "barely hitting his prime" either. Watson plays recklessly in the pocket and is overly reliant on legs to create time to make plays downfield instead of just making progressions in the pocket. Credit to him that he didn't miss more games except for the freak ACL injury his rookie year, while guys like Baker Mayfield are always getting banged up, but he's not gonna age the same way that pocket passers do both because he will beat himself up more physically and also because his play style is dependent on athleticism that's going to decline, especially exposing himself to repeated hits like he does.

He also hasn't played football for a full season and might be affected a bit by the ordeal he's been through the last year.
